@import"https://fonts.googleapis.com/css2?family=Noto+Sans+JP:wght@100..900&display=swap";@import"https://fonts.googleapis.com/css2?family=Roboto:ital,wght@0,100..900;1,100..900&display=swap";@import"https://use.typekit.net/qgx7czh.css";#entry__main{padding-bottom:8rem}@media screen and (max-width: 767px){#entry__main{padding-bottom:4rem}}#entry__main .entry__navi .navi__list{display:grid;grid-template-columns:repeat(3, 1fr);gap:2.4rem}@media screen and (max-width: 767px){#entry__main .entry__navi .navi__list{grid-template-columns:repeat(1, 1fr);gap:.8rem}}#entry__main .entry__navi .navi__list__item a{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ative;padding:0 2.4rem;height:10rem;border-radius:.8rem;background:#000}@media screen and (max-width: 767px){#entry__main .entry__navi .navi__list__item a{padding:0 1.6rem;height:5.6rem}}#entry__main .entry__navi .navi__list__item a::after{content:"";display:block;position:absolute;top:50%;right:1.6rem;-webkit-transform:translateY(-50%);transform:translateY(-50%);width:1.5rem;height:2.4rem;background:url("../img/common/icon-chevron.svg") no-repeat;background-size:cover}@media screen and (max-width: 767px){#entry__main .entry__navi .navi__list__item a::after{width:1rem;height:1.6rem}}#entry__main .entry__navi .navi__list__item a i{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-right:1.2rem}@media screen and (max-width: 767px){#entry__main .entry__navi .navi__list__item a i{margin-right:.6rem}}#entry__main .entry__navi .navi__list__item a i svg{max-width:4rem;max-height:4rem;fill:#fff}@media screen and (max-width: 767px){#entry__main .entry__navi .navi__list__item a i svg{max-width:2rem;max-height:2rem}}#entry__main .entry__navi .navi__list__item a span{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;font-size:2rem;font-weight:700;color:#fff}@media screen and (max-width: 767px){#entry__main .entry__navi .navi__list__item a span{font-size:1.3rem}}#entry__main .entry__navi .navi__list__item a span small{margin-bottom:.4rem}#entry__main .entry__navi .navi__list__item a:hover{background:#ea574c}@media screen and (max-width: 767px){#entry__lower{padding-bottom:0}}#entry__lower .grid-container{display:grid;grid-template-columns:24rem 90rem;-webkit-box-align:start;-ms-flex-align:start;align-items:start;grid-template-areas:"area1 area2";gap:6rem}@media screen and (max-width: 767px){#entry__lower .grid-container{grid-template-columns:repeat(1, 1fr);grid-template-areas:"area1" "area2";gap:4.8rem}}#entry__lower .grid-container .contents__main{grid-area:area2}@media screen and (max-width: 767px){#entry__lower .grid-container .contents__main{grid-area:area1}}#entry__lower .grid-container .contents__sub{grid-area:area1}@media screen and (max-width: 767px){#entry__lower .grid-container .contents__sub{grid-area:area2}}#entry__lower .contents__main .title__block,#entry__lower .contents__sub .title__block{padding-bottom:2.4rem;border-bottom:.1rem solid #000}@media screen and (max-width: 767px){#entry__lower .contents__main .title__block,#entry__lower .contents__sub .title__block{padding-bottom:1.6rem}}#entry__lower .contents__main>.title__block{margin-bottom:0}#entry__lower .contents__main>.title__block .jp{position:relative;padding-left:4.8rem}@media screen and (max-width: 767px){#entry__lower .contents__main>.title__block .jp{padding-left:2.8rem}}#entry__lower .contents__main>.title__block .jp i{position:absolute;top:50%;left:0;-webkit-transform:translateY(-50%);transform:translateY(-50%)}#entry__lower .contents__main>.title__block .jp i svg{max-width:4rem;max-height:4rem;fill:#000}@media screen and (max-width: 767px){#entry__lower .contents__main>.title__block .jp i svg{max-width:2.4rem;max-height:2.4rem}}#entry__lower .contents__main .guideline__list__item{border-bottom:.1rem solid #000}#entry__lower .contents__main .guideline__list__item .guideline__title,#entry__lower .contents__main .guideline__list__item .guideline__detail{padding:2.4rem 1.6r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__title,#entry__lower .contents__main .guideline__list__item .guideline__detail{padding:1.6rem .4rem}}#entry__lower .contents__main .guideline__list__item .guideline__title{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;border-bottom:.1rem dashed #ddd}#entry__lower .contents__main .guideline__list__item .guideline__title em{margin-right:.4rem;font-family:"rift-soft",sans-serif;font-size:2.4rem;font-weight:500;color:#ea574c}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__title em{font-size:1.8rem}}#entry__lower .contents__main .guideline__list__item .guideline__title span{margin-top:.2rem;font-size:1.6rem;font-weight:700}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__title span{font-size:1.3r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ail>*:not(:last-child){margin-bottom:1.6r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ail>*:not(:last-child){margin-bottom:.8r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ail div>*:not(:last-child){margin-bottom:.4rem}#entry__lower .contents__main .guideline__list__item .guideline__detail ul li,#entry__lower .contents__main .guideline__list__item .guideline__detail ol li{line-height:1.25}#entry__lower .contents__main .guideline__list__item .guideline__detail ul ul,#entry__lower .contents__main .guideline__list__item .guideline__detail ul ol,#entry__lower .contents__main .guideline__list__item .guideline__detail ol ul,#entry__lower .contents__main .guideline__list__item .guideline__detail ol ol{padding-left:2.4rem;margin-bottom:.4rem}#entry__lower .contents__main .guideline__list__item .guideline__detail ul li{display:-webkit-box;display:-ms-flexbox;display:flex}#entry__lower .contents__main .guideline__list__item .guideline__detail ul li:not(:last-child){margin-bottom:.6rem}#entry__lower .contents__main .guideline__list__item .guideline__detail ul li::before{content:"・";margin-right:.2rem}#entry__lower .contents__main .guideline__list__item .guideline__detail ol{counter-reset:cnt_num}#entry__lower .contents__main .guideline__list__item .guideline__detail ol li{display:-webkit-box;display:-ms-flexbox;display:flex}#entry__lower .contents__main .guideline__list__item .guideline__detail ol li:not(:last-child){margin-bottom:.4r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ail ol li:not(:last-child){margin-bottom:.2r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ail ol li::before{counter-increment:cnt_num;content:counter(cnt_num, decimal-leading-zero) ".";margin-right:.2rem;font-family:"rift-soft",sans-serif;font-size:1.8rem;color:#0298b3}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ail ol li::before{font-size:1.3r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ail ol li span{margin-top:.4r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ail ol li span{margin-top:.2r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ail dl{display:grid;grid-template-columns:16rem 1fr;gap:1.6rem 0}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ail dl{grid-template-columns:6rem 1fr;gap:1.2rem 0}}#entry__lower .contents__main .guideline__list__item .guideline__detail dl dt:not(:last-of-type),#entry__lower .contents__main .guideline__list__item .guideline__detail dl dd:not(:last-of-type){padding-bottom:1.6r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ail dl dt:not(:last-of-type),#entry__lower .contents__main .guideline__list__item .guideline__detail dl dd:not(:last-of-type){padding-bottom:1.2r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ail dl dt{font-weight:700;line-height:1.25}#entry__lower .contents__main .guideline__list__item .guideline__detail dl dt:not(:last-of-type){border-bottom:.1rem solid #000}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ail dl dd{padding-left:.8r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ail dl dd:not(:last-of-type){border-bottom:.1rem solid #ddd}#entry__lower .contents__main .guideline__list__item .guideline__detail dl dd>*:not(:last-child){margin-bottom:1.6r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ail dl dd>*:not(:last-child){margin-bottom:.8r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ail .cloakroom__guide{display:grid;grid-template-columns:repeat(3, 1fr);gap:1.6rem}@media screen and (max-width: 767px){#entry__lower .contents__main .guideline__list__item .guideline__detail .cloakroom__guide{gap:.8rem}}#entry__lower .contents__main .guideline__list__item .guideline__detail .cloakroom__guide figure{margin-bottom:0}#entry__lower .contents__main .guideline__list__item .guideline__detail .cloakroom__guide figure img{width:auto;height:auto}#entry__lower .contents__main .guideline__list__item .guideline__detail .cloakroom__guide figure figcaption{margin-top:.8rem}#entry__lower .contents__main .guideline__list__item .guideline__detail a{text-decoration:underline}#entry__lower .contents__main .entry{margin-top:8rem}@media screen and (max-width: 767px){#entry__lower .contents__main .entry{margin-top:4rem}}#entry__lower .contents__sub{position:sticky;top:10rem}@media screen and (max-width: 767px){#entry__lower .contents__sub{position:static}}#entry__lower .contents__sub .list__main__item.is-current>a i svg{fill:#ea574c}#entry__lower .contents__sub .list__main__item.is-current>a span{color:#ea574c}#entry__lower .contents__sub .list__main__item.is-current .list__sub{display:block}#entry__lower .contents__sub .list__main__item:not(:last-child){margin-bottom:1.2rem}@media screen and (max-width: 767px){#entry__lower .contents__sub .list__main__item:not(:last-child){margin-bottom:.8rem}}#entry__lower .contents__sub .list__main__item>a{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}#entry__lower .contents__sub .list__main__item>a i{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-right:.4rem}#entry__lower .contents__sub .list__main__item>a i svg{max-width:1.8rem;max-height:1.8rem;fill:#000}@media screen and (max-width: 767px){#entry__lower .contents__sub .list__main__item>a i svg{max-width:1.6rem;max-height:1.6rem}}#entry__lower .contents__sub .list__main__item>a span{font-size:1.6rem;font-weight:700}@media screen and (max-width: 767px){#entry__lower .contents__sub .list__main__item>a span{font-size:1.3rem}}#entry__lower .contents__sub .list__main__item>a:hover i svg{fill:#ea574c}#entry__lower .contents__sub .list__main__item .list__sub{display:none;padding-left:2.4rem;margin-top:1.2rem}@media screen and (max-width: 767px){#entry__lower .contents__sub .list__main__item .list__sub{padding-left:2rem;margin-top:.8rem}}#entry__lower .contents__sub .list__main__item .list__sub.is-empty{display:none}#entry__lower .contents__sub .list__main__item .list__sub__item:not(:last-child){margin-bottom:.6rem}@media screen and (max-width: 767px){#entry__lower .contents__sub .list__main__item .list__sub__item:not(:last-child){margin-bottom:.4rem}}#entry__lower .contents__sub .list__main__item .list__sub__item a{display:-webkit-box;display:-ms-flexbox;display:flex}#entry__lower .contents__sub .list__main__item .list__sub__item a::before{content:"";display:block;margin:.7rem .4rem 0 0;width:1.2rem;height:.1rem;background:#ddd;-webkit-transition:.3s;transition:.3s}#entry__lower .contents__sub .list__main__item .list__sub__item a:hover::before{background:#ea574c}#entry__form .form__contents>.txt{margin-bottom:6.4rem}#entry__form .form__contents .c-form__area .form__list .wrap .form__list__item{border-top:none}#entry__form .form__contents .c-form__area .form__list__item .flex-container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}#entry__form .form__contents .c-form__area .form__list__item .coupon__area{gap:.8rem}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input{margin-right:.8rem;padding:0 1.6rem;width:100%;height:4.8rem;border:none;outline:none;background:#f5f5f5}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input:focus{outline:.1rem solid #0298b3}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input::-webkit-input-placeholder{font-size:1.2rem;color:#999}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input::-moz-placeholder{font-size:1.2rem;color:#999}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input:-ms-input-placeholder{font-size:1.2rem;color:#999}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input::-ms-input-placeholder{font-size:1.2rem;color:#999}#entry__form .form__contents .c-form__area .form__list__item .coupon__area input::placeholder{font-size:1.2rem;color:#999}@media screen and (max-width: 767px){#entry__form .form__contents .c-form__area .form__list__item .coupon__area input{height:4rem}}#entry__form .form__contents .c-form__area .form__list__item .coupon__area button{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;position:relative;padding:0 1.6rem;width:24rem;height:4.8rem;border-radius:.8rem;background:#000;font-family:"rift-soft",sans-serif;font-weight:700;color:#fff !important;-webkit-transition:.3s;transition:.3s}@media screen and (max-width: 767px){#entry__form .form__contents .c-form__area .form__list__item .coupon__area button{padding:0 1.6rem;width:16rem;height:4rem}}#entry__form .form__contents .c-form__area .form__list__item .coupon__area button::after{content:"";display:block;position:absolute;top:50%;right:1.2rem;-webkit-transform:translateY(-50%);transform:translateY(-50%);width:1rem;height:1.6rem;background:url("../img/common/icon-chevron.svg") no-repeat;background-size:cover}#entry__form .form__contents .c-form__area .form__list__item .coupon__area button:hover{background:#ea574c}#entry__form .form__contents .c-form__area .form__list__item>* span{font-family:"Roboto",sans-serif;font-weight:700}#entry__form .form__contents .c-form__area .form__list__item>* span.amount{font-size:1.8rem}#entry__form .form__contents .c-form__area .form__list__item>* span.amount::after{content:"円（税込）";font-family:"Helvetica Neue",Arial,"Noto Sans JP","Hiragino Kaku Gothic ProN","Hiragino Sans",Meiryo,sans-serif;font-size:1.2rem}#entry__form .form__contents .c-form__area .form__list__item>* span.quantity{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-flex:1;-ms-flex:1;flex:1;font-size:1.8rem}#entry__form .form__contents .c-form__area .form__list__item>* span.quantity::before{content:"×";display:inline-block;margin:.2rem .8rem 0}#entry__form .form__contents .c-form__area .form__list__item>* span.quantity::after{content:"";display:block;-webkit-box-flex:1;-ms-flex:1;flex:1;margin:0 1.6rem;width:auto;height:.1rem;background-color:#ddd}#entry__form .form__contents .c-form__area .form__list__item>* span.total{margin-left:auto;font-size:2.4rem}#entry__form .form__contents .c-form__area .form__list__item>* span.total::after{content:"円（税込）";font-family:"Helvetica Neue",Arial,"Noto Sans JP","Hiragino Kaku Gothic ProN","Hiragino Sans",Meiryo,sans-serif;font-size:1.2rem}#entry__form .form__contents .c-form__area .form__list__item #union-generate-btn{padding:0 1.6rem;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;border:.1rem solid #ddd;border-radius:.4rem;background:#f5f5f5;font-weight:700;-webkit-transition:.3s;transition:.3s}#entry__form .form__contents .c-form__area .form__list__item #union-generate-btn:hover{background:#0298b3;color:#fff}#page__guide::after{content:"GUIDELINE MENU"}/*# sourceMappingURL=entry.css.map */